Earlier Mac OS releases did not support an APFS file system with Time Machine. Since Mac OS x Big Sur you have the choice to format as APFS (Apple File System) and use for a Time Machine backup. You’ll need to change its file system format to APFS or Mac OS Extended (Journaled). Western Digital ships your WD Elements drive NTFS formatted. Put Your WD Elements External Drive In A Mac Format.
